Elvira M. Cardona

August 23, 1965 — December 13, 2025

Tucson, AZ

Our mother was a strong, determined woman whose love showed through her actions, sacrifices, and unwavering commitment to her family. She was stern and strict, yet deeply caring, and she believed in doing what needed to be done. No matter how hard it was.

She worked tirelessly and took great pride in her independence and in providing for those she loved. Accomplishing things on her own was not just a necessity for her, but a source of pride. She was a reliable presence in many people's lives, always stepping up when others needed her.

One of her greatest joys was the holidays. Her home was the gathering place where everyone was welcome, and no one ever left hungry. She took pride in bringing family together, making sure every seat was filled and everyone felt cared for in her own special way.

Elvira loved her house plants and always had some of the most beautiful roses in her yard.

Her voice and energy were very distinctive; you always heard “Vera! " or " Tia Vida!” when she walked into a room.

Surviving family members include devoted children: daughter Vanessa and son Cristobal; her grandchildren, Mia and Alexia, affectionately known as "Lexi"; cherished mother, Elvia, who provided unwavering support and love; sisters; Lisa and Norma, as well as brothers; Michael, Carlos, and David as well as her nieces, nephews and friends. She was deeply devoted to her two fur babies, Sangee and Cariño, who were constantly by her side—bringing comfort during illness and lifting her spirits during difficult moments.

She shared a rare and beautiful bond with her mother, Elvia, a closeness that went far beyond family. Their relationship was rooted in deep love, devotion, and friendship; they were truly each other's best friends.

We will honor the remarkable life of our beloved Elvira. Her enduring legacy of love and connection has left an indelible mark on the hearts of all who had the privilege to know her. As we reflect upon the memories shared and the bonds forged, we are reminded of the warmth and kindness that she consistently imparted to those around her. Her spirit will continue to illuminate our lives, forever cherished and never forgotten.
